Action item: The Relayn deploy-status bot silently dropped updates when the pipeline API paginated results, so responders believed a rollback had completed when it had not. We will add pagination handling, a staleness banner, and an integration test. Until merged, verify deploy state directly in the pipeline console, documented at the page below.

runbook for kahop-kajop: https://rundeck.ordinio.test/display/secrets/pipeline/issue/pages/repo/browse/e5732776e07d1285107e5aeb

**Ticket: Grainlink gateway drops telemetry bursts after combine power-cycles**

Heya future maintainers. The Grainlink telemetry gateway at the Dovermoor test farm loses the first ~40 seconds of CAN data whenever a Harrowfield combine power-cycles mid-field. Looks like the session handshake with the uplink broker retries on a fixed backoff, and the ring buffer gets flushed instead of parked. Workaround for now: bump the buffer park flag in staging config. Repro is reliable on the bench rig using the firmware build tokened below.

session token of tajef-bageg = htk21_5d90d574934f3ccae6437

### 2.9.1 — Deep-link routing key rotation

Heads up, support folks: we rotated the signing key for Wayfinder's mobile deep links. Old links keep working until end of month, then verification will start rejecting them — users will land on the generic home screen instead of the target view. If a customer reports broken links from fresh emails, check their app version first (needs 2.9+). For manual link generation in the admin console, use the new key below.

signing key of bagap-yawep = bky13_TbfT6ZMUoGJo2